Transaction 5ef7551135974acad20f0e5c2ab35bd7139089a29796257e42bb487357f523af
1 Input
1 Output
-
5ef7551135974acad20f0e5c2ab35bd7139089a29796257e42bb487357f523af:0
- value
- 11290000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5677b57a829de8cdfce2625b58d42a4121a4d25 OP_EQUAL
- address
- 3M9PpSoCSTRdcXFRtAXKyGct7Pf8ScLZ3v